College Summary
Before we complete the college review, let us look at the College details of Mahatma Gandhi Missions Medical College Aurangabad.
| Name of Institute | Mahatma Gandhi Missions Medical College Aurangabad |
| Popular Name | MGM Medical College Aurangabad |
| Location | Aurangabad, Maharashtra |
| Year of Establishment | 1990 |
| Institute Type | Deemed |
| Courses Offered | MBBS |
| Exam | NEET UG |
| Affiliated to | MGM Institute of Health Sciences (Deemed University), Navi Mumbai |
| Approved by | National Medical Commission (NMC) |
| Counselling Conducted Authority | Medical Counselling Committee (MCC) |
| Official Website | https://www.mgmmcha.org/ |
| Category | Medical College in Maharashtra |

Admission 2026-27
If you want to MGM Medical College Aurangabad NRI Quota Admission for the MBBS Course, you must follow the college admission procedure:
| Particular | Description |
| Eligibility Criteria | UG: Candidates must pass 12th with PCB and English, scoring 50% marks and 40% for reserved categories. At least 17 years old by December 31 of the admission year. |
| Entrance Exam | MBBS: NEET UG |
| NEET UG Counselling | After qualifying NEET-UG, register for the Central Government Counselling for Deemed Universities on the MCC website (Medical Counselling Committee). |
Fee Structure for NRI Quota
In this Section, we provide information regarding the MGM Medical College Aurangabad NRI Fees.
| Particular | Fees per Annum (USD) | Fees per Annum (INR) |
| Tuition Fees | $ 54,938/- | Rs. 21,00,000/- |
Cutoff 2025
The table below displays the MGM Medical College Aurangabad NRI Cutoff for General category (All India) in the initial round of counselling for MBBS admissions at MGM Medical College Aurangabad, determined by NEET-UG scores.
| Rounds | 2023 | 2024 | 2025 |
| R-1 | 257540 | 217487 | 208996 |
| R-2 | 191249 | 138732 | 277135 |
| R-3 | 199504 | 140840 | 297942 |
| R-4 & Last Round | 91313 | 140840 (R3) | 89745 |
Documents Required
Below are the documents required for the NRI Quota at MGM Medical College in Aurangabad.
- DGHS Allotment Letter.
- NEET 2024 Hall Ticket / Admit Card issued by NTA ( National Testing Agency).
- NEET 2024 Result / Rank Letter issued by NTA ( National Testing Agency).
- 10th Standard Marks Card / Date of Birth Certificate for proof of DOB (if 10th certificate does not bear the same).
- Marks Card of 10+2 of India or equivalent examination (A Levels, IB, HSC, Year 12, etc.).
- 10+2 Certificate(for students who have followed the 10+2 of India).
- Cast Certificate SC/ST/OBC (if applicable).
- Transfer/ Migration Certificate [Undergraduate].
- Conduct / Character certificate from last school/Institute.
- Self –Attested copy of Pan Card (Parent & Candidate) for Indian Citizens.
- Self –Attested copy of Aadhar Card of Candidate (compulsory for Indian residents).
- Fee Remittance Details (Refer Table 1B for Payment Mode).
- 1 set of self-attested Photocopies, of all of the above documents.
- 8 recent Identical Passport sized photographs.
- Post Dated Cheques for whole course fees to be submitted at the time of admission.
- EWS Certificate is mandatory if admission allotment is under EWS category.
- ‘Equivalence Certificate’ from the Association of Indian Universities, New Delhi in case of Students with Foreign qualifications.
- Copy of Student Visa/OCI (original to be produced for verification).
- Affidavit of the person who is NRI and the Sponsorer.
- Documents Claiming the Sponsorer is an NRI( Passport, Visa of the Sponsorer).
- Embassy Certificate of the Sponsorer.
- Relationship of NRI with the candidate (As per the directions/orders of the Hon’ble Supreme Court of India in the case (W.P.(C) No.689/2017-Consortium of Deemed Universities in Karnataka(CODEUNIK) & Anr. Vs Union of India & Ors.)dated 22-08-2017).
- Passport copy of Student( NRI Candidates only).
- Letter from the Indian Embassy(for NRI parents).
- Affidavit from the Sponsorer that he/she will sponsor the entire course fee of the candidate.
- Income tax Document Required as per Income Tax Act 1961.

Frequently Asked Questions(FAQ’s)
What is the NRI quota in MGM Medical College, Aurangabad?
The NRI quota is a reserved category of seats for Non-Resident Indians (NRIs) and their eligible wards, as per regulatory guidelines.
Who is eligible for NRI quota admission?
NRIs, Overseas Citizens of India (OCI), Persons of Indian Origin (PIO), and candidates sponsored by an NRI relative are eligible under the NRI quota.
Is NEET qualification mandatory for NRI quota admission?
Yes, qualifying NEET-UG is mandatory for admission under the NRI quota as per medical admission regulations.
What documents are required for NRI quota admission?
Required documents include NEET scorecard, passport, NRI proof, sponsorship affidavit (if applicable), relationship proof, and academic certificates.
How is admission processed under the NRI quota?
Admission is done through the official counselling process based on NEET rank, eligibility criteria, document verification, and seat availability.
